]> git.tuebingen.mpg.de Git - paraslash.git/blobdiff - audiod.c
fd: Drop fd_set parameter from read_nonblock() and friends.
[paraslash.git] / audiod.c
index 119adbc0be2ddbf24a7d06de4b77a5a3d88bd230..482cce377801189ffdeec9aa0862834aa27248b2 100644 (file)
--- a/audiod.c
+++ b/audiod.c
@@ -1063,7 +1063,7 @@ static int signal_post_select(struct sched *s, void *context)
        ret = task_get_notification(st->task);
        if (ret < 0)
                return ret;
-       signum = para_next_signal(&s->rfds);
+       signum = para_next_signal();
        switch (signum) {
        case SIGINT:
        case SIGTERM:
@@ -1510,8 +1510,7 @@ int main(int argc, char *argv[])
                .context = signal_task,
        }, &sched);
 
-       sched.default_timeout.tv_sec = 2;
-       sched.default_timeout.tv_usec = 999 * 1000;
+       sched.default_timeout = 2999;
        ret = schedule(&sched);
        audiod_cleanup();
        sched_shutdown(&sched);